Page 23 text:

JUNIOR CLASS First row, left to right: Helen DonifT, Jeanette Niemeyer, Ruth Fogle, Velma Martin, Genevieve Lawson, Clara Karpowicz, Helen Kowalin- ski, Ermel Raney, Jane Purcell, Richard Mefford, Eugene Blacklidge. Second row: Lorene Antoine, Laura Nollman, Fern Peebles, Robert Hocking, Vasil Vasileff, Juan Doyen, James Shipcoff, Woodrow Lybarger, Frank Brown. Upper row: Edith Ray, Margaret Lewis, Everette McCart, Frank Wondra, Henry McMullen, Leonard Miller, Alec Gitcho, Lloyd Williams. Adam Zentgraf. CLASS OFFICERS Everette McCart ............................... President Laura Nollman ............................ Vice-President Vasil Vasileff ................................ Treasurer Page nineteen

Page 24 text:

SOPHOMORE CLASS First row: Ralph Johnson, John Blattner, Thomas Studebaker, Bruce Hill, Paul Connole, Lester Goode, Joe Lewis. Second row: Margaret Hayes, Catherine Popova, Wilma Opich, Cath- erine Cohan, Ruby Gentry, Erma Daugherty, Gabriella Chizek, Marie Schnitzius, Marcella Wathen, Sylvia Megeff, Marguerite Polette, Maxine Werner, Gilbert Rosch. Third row: Mae Levy, Mary Modric, Jennie Hasten, Marian Harlan, June Fogle, Edna Ridgeway, Elizabeth Lee, Helen Harshany, Jessie Git- cho, Eloise Barr, Joe Mejeski, Olan Richardson, Rudolph Chizek. Fourth row: Mary Ashford. Irene Borah, Helen McMullen, A1 Weis- man, Glendola Stein, Alfred Schrieber, Edward Foehse, Frank Cohan, Fred Riddle, Sigmund Sawicki, Roy Hill, Dan Graville, Lawrence Burris, Joe Radman, Kenneth Williams. CLASS OFFICERS Marie Schnitzius ............................ President Thomas Studebaker ......................... Vice-President Joe Radman ...................... Secretary and Treasurer Page twenty
